API Call Limits

eBay APIs support a large number of applications and serve billions of API calls every month. To maintain a high level of availability and provide superior quality of service, eBay limits the API call usage. The limits on the total calls and the rate at which the calls can be made depend on the API.

Our default API call limits are designed for individuals and smaller businesses. If your volume increases, you can get higher limits after completing our Application Growth Check.

After you join the eBay Developers Program and get your application keyset, you can start using eBay APIs immediately. The default call limits on the eBay APIs allow you to test and explore the API capabilities. Many applications are able to perform all capabilities using the default limits. If you need higher call limits, you can complete our Application Growth Check, to verify that your application is adhering to eBay's API License Agreement, and that you've made the most efficient use of the APIs you've implemented.

The following table provides the default API call limit rates for individuals and smaller businesses.

GraphQL API Rate Limits

Unlike REST APIs, which apply call limits at the API level, Public GraphQL rate limits are applied to individual root operation fields. Each root operation field (query or mutation) has its own default call limit, independent of other fields in the same operation.

The following table lists the default rate limits for Public GraphQL root operation fields.

Functional Group API Name Root Operation Field Default Call Limits
Listing Management Inventory Mapping query.listingPreviewsCreationTaskById 20 API calls per day
Listing Management Inventory Mapping mutation.startListingPreviewsCreation 20 API calls per day

When a call exceeds its root-operation-field rate limit, the API returns HTTP 200 with a GraphQL execution-time error: extensions.errorCode = RATE_LIMITED. See the RATE_LIMITED error code in Response Status and Error Codes → GraphQL API Errors for details.
